Crans Montana Forum agenda announced

The Azerbaijani capital Baku will host an annual Crans Montana Forum from June 28 to July 1.

The forum, which will take place at the invitation of the Azerbaijani government, will be devoted to the public and private governance as far as energy policy is concerned.

Among the invited leaders are Georgian President Mikheil Saakashvili, President of Macedonia Gjorge Ivanov, Montenegrin President Filip Vujanovic, Crown Prince of the UAE Emirate of Fujairah, Sheikh Hamad bin Mohammed Al Sharqi, Prince Jean of Luxembourg, founder of the Crans Montana Forum Jean-Paul Carteron and other dignitaries.

The forum will focus on Azerbaijan`s role in supplying energy to Eastern Europe, the Middle East situation and the monitoring of ethical practices in international corporate policy.

Crans Montana Forum is a Swiss organization established in Crans-Montana, Switzerland in 1986, which cooperates closely with major international organizations.
